Fentanyl is a synthetic opioid known for its extreme potency, estimated to be 50‑100 times stronger than morphine. It may be legally prescribed for severe pain, such as after surgery or for cancer-related pain, but many overdose deaths are now linked to illicit fentanyl mixed into heroin, cocaine, methamphetamine, or counterfeit pills without the person knowing
According to public health data, fentanyl is one of the major drivers of overdose deaths in the United States. Even a very small amount can be fatal, making fentanyl use especially dangerous
